I used that backpack on another server and I did notice it screwed up some of my character animations and spells.
I was playing a human male cleric of Lathander and when he would cast Light (the module was very dark and Light was necessary), the Light spell wouldn't work right--the area it lit-up was much smaller than it should have been because the lightsource was placed right in front of the character's face instead of over his head, so it didn't light up behind the character at all. At first I didn't kow why stuff was screwed up but then I noticed my healing spells were animating wrong when I cast them and came to realise it was all my spells animating wrong too. Other characters weren't having a problem so at first I thought it was my character's head-model but then I had a character with a different head-model try it and he had the same problem so I took off my character's armour and tried and my spells cast fine. My armour was using all standard NWN components except the backpack so when I took it off my animations were fixed. I hope they've fixed that problem since I used the model (around September 05) but I'm not holding my breath. It does look cool, and I'd love to use it if it worked right. Hey I have a general question concerning the CEP. How does the CEP crafting system work? It "wraps" around the Bioware crafting functions. Basically it just overwrites the old Bioware crafting conversations and inserts new options. It then allows you to change your armor/character appearance. We ask that you not add any body parts to your character that wouldn't normally be there. Have fun crafting your armor/clothing to any appearance you would like. Does that answer your question?
